UserSplit Cutover Drift: the extracted account service and the legacy Marigold monolith user module are reporting divergent record counts during dual-write. This fires when drift exceeds 0.5% over 15 minutes. New team members should not replay writes manually. Reconciliation steps and the rollback procedure are documented on the internal page.

wiki page, tajog-fafog: https://gitlab.paliqsys.corp/dash/display/job/853dd6fcbf54

# Migration note for reviewers:
# All cron jobs formerly in scheduler/crontab.d are now Driftwheel workflows.
# Do not re-add cron entries; they will conflict with Driftwheel's lease locks.
# Workflow definitions live in workflows/*.dw; the runner picks them up on boot.
# Retry policy defaults to 3 attempts, exponential backoff. Override per-workflow, not globally.
# The runner must authenticate to the Driftwheel coordinator at startup.
# Its credential is set on the next line of this file:

secret setting of hawep-yahig: LEDGER_TOKEN29=41b5d6315371c92885eaeb077fb63

Briefing for leadership review — prepared for the incoming director. Summary: Ostrander Devices disputes our licensing of the Calyx sensor firmware, alleging scope overreach in the field-service module. Counsel considers our position defensible but recommends settlement talks. Exposure is manageable; product timelines unaffected so far. Next checkpoint is the mediation session. The confidential note on related business plans follows below.

board note of kageg-bahof: The renewal with Holwynax Holdings closes at $2 million a year, 5 percent below the last contract. Project Ulaath slips by two quarters because of the supplier delay.

Quarterly Planning Note — Reseller Programme

The Tallin Partner Programme now has 14 active resellers, up from 9. Margin tiers hold at 20/25/30. Two underperformers in the Verriton territory will be exited at renewal. Onboarding cost per reseller fell 18%. Target for next quarter: 20 partners, with emphasis on the Northfell corridor. Training materials ship next month. The programme's structure anticipates a development the board should note separately below.

internal memo for yajeg-fahof: Casaxek Freight plans to raise the Belael list price by 53.4 percent in June. The finance team signed off on a budget of $298.3 million for Project Pelax. The renewal with Fravanox Logistics closes at $209.5 million a year, 29.2 percent below the last contract. Project Praax slips by two quarters because of the staffing delay.